Dishes
Salt-Baked Young PigeonA traditional Cantonese dish featuring young pigeon marinated in coarse salt and slow-baked to tender perfection, delivering a rich, savory flavor.
Salt-Baked PigeonA traditional Chinese dish featuring fresh pigeon seasoned with coarse salt and slowly roasted to tender, flavorful perfection.
Sand Ginger PigeonA Cantonese dish featuring pigeon stewed with sand ginger, garlic, and ginger, resulting in tender meat and aromatic flavor.
Dianbai Cuttlefish CakeDianbai cuttlefish cake is a specialty snack from Dianbai, Guangdong, made with fresh cuttlefish, pork, and starch, shaped into cakes and pan-fried. It has a tender, chewy texture with a fresh oceanic flavor.
Sweet Potato LeavesSweet potato leaves are a nutritious green vegetable commonly stir-fried or used in soups, known for their mild flavor and tender texture.
